There are several educational requirements to become a senior finance specialist. Senior finance specialists usually study business, accounting, or finance. 68% of senior finance specialists hold a bachelor's degree, and 15% hold an master's degree. | Rank | Major | Percentages |
|---|---|---|
| 1 | Business | 31.4% |
| 2 | Accounting | 20.5% |
| 3 | Finance | 17.6% |
| 4 | Economics | 4.9% |
| 5 | Management | 4.8% |

| Senior finance specialist education level | Senior finance specialist salary |
|---|---|
| Master's Degree | $104,520 |
| Bachelor's Degree | $88,824 |
| Doctorate Degree | $125,131 |
